Saskatchewan invites in-demand specialists

About 400 people with certain professions were selected in the selection.

On September 27, the Saskatchewan Immigration Programme issued 391 invitations to apply for a nomination from the province.

The invitations were distributed as follows:

The passing score in the system "Expression of interest" for both categories was 71. This is 5 points higher than in the previous selection, which took place on 8 September.

The invited candidates had experience in one of 61 suitable professions. The list includes managers and supervisors in various fields, supervisors, administrative staff, technologists, medics, educators, production workers and others.

In addition to having a suitable profession, applicants for immigration to Saskatchewan are assessed on factors such as work experience, education, language, age and links to the province.
